The shell and core approach was first developed by commercial property developers in the US, but became popular in the UK with the ground-breaking Broadgate development in London during the mid-1980s.

It involves the construction of a building’s central structure – a ‘blank canvass’ that includes its main services, walls and windows – and leaving its customisation to the client, leaseholder or tenant by way of an interior design fit-out.

Separating these phases helps to not only reduce the cost of construction, but also minimises running costs thanks to the concrete core’s energy-efficiency and heat-storage qualities. It also allows developers and clients to work up the project’s fit-out while the shell and core works are under way.
